EXP-1730 FIX
EXP-1731 FIX EXP-1735 FIX EXP-1736 FIX EXP-1737 FIX EXP-1738 FIX EXP-1739 FIX * Users can no longer drag and drop items to the outbox from in world, notecards or the library. * Drag and drop now blocks the creation of hierarchies that are too deep, too many folders or contain too many items. * Settings now exist to specify drag and drop limitations to the outbox, named: InventoryOutboxMaxFolderDepth (4) InventoryOutboxMaxFolderCount (20) InventoryOutboxMaxItemCount (200)

+//
+// Search up the parent chain until we get to the specified parent, then return the first child category under it
+//
+const LLViewerInventoryCategory* LLInventoryModel::getFirstDescendantOf(const LLUUID& master_parent_id, const LLUUID& obj_id) const
+{
+ if (master_parent_id == obj_id)
+ {
+ return NULL;
+ }
+
+ const LLViewerInventoryCategory* current_cat = getCategory(obj_id);
+
+ if (current_cat == NULL)
+ {
+ current_cat = getCategory(getObject(obj_id)->getParentUUID());
+ }
+
+ while (current_cat != NULL)
+ {
+ const LLUUID& current_parent_id = current_cat->getParentUUID();
+
+ if (current_parent_id == master_parent_id)
+ {
+ return current_cat;
+ }
+
+ current_cat = getCategory(current_parent_id);
+ }
+
+ return NULL;
+}
